尝试配置Visual Studio远程调试程序时出现红框

时间:2016-04-12 03:30:36

标签: visual-studio-2015 remote-debugging device-driver

尝试在Visual Studio 2015 1 中配置机器进行调试时,配置设备周围有一个奇怪的红框,并选择调试器设置选项:

enter image description here

我没有在屏幕截图中放置那个红色框;它确实存在于Visual Studio 2015用户界面中。

我的问题是:

  • 这个红盒试图告诉我什么
  • 为什么我无法添加新的目标设备(即下一步完成始终被禁用(无论我输入什么显示名称,或我检查哪个单选按钮) ))
  • 如何远程调试设备驱动程序?

背景

在MSDN中详细记录了在Visual Studio中设置内核模式调试:

Setting Up Kernel-Mode Debugging of a Virtual Machine in Visual Studio

只有两个问题:

  

配置主机

     

主机可以是运行虚拟机的物理计算机,也可以是单独的计算机   1.在主机上,在Visual Studio中的驱动程序菜单上,选择测试> 配置计算机

第一个问题是驱动程序>中没有配置计算机选项。 测试菜单:

enter image description here

文档刚刚过时

问题2.我们假设文档已过期,而且它们实际上是指驱动程序> 测试> 配置设备,崩溃:

enter image description here

这是Visual Studio 2015 Update 1中众所周知的回归:

  

Microsoft Connect: Fails to load Configure Devices (已结束)

     

1/12/2016 Gabriel [MSFT]

     

我为延迟沟通而道歉。简而言之,此错误最近已得到修复,更改应反映在Visual Studio 2015的未来更新中。

该问题于1月份结束。四个月后,Visual Studio 2015 Update 2已经发布,但仍然存在问题:

  

2016年2月11日
  VS2015更新2 CTP仍然在WDK10 10.0.10586.0中断。

     

2016年3月25日
  还是坏了。

     

2016年4月9日
  VS2015更新2与最新的WDK仍然破碎.....

通过其他方式访问配置UI

虽然有一组VS人员通过记录的方式破解了对设备配置用户界面的访问权限;仍然没有未记录的方式来访问设备配置用户界面。 Justin Stenning pointed it out right here on Stackoverflow

enter image description here

我能够达到:它导致我在顶部显示的屏幕截图 - 一个不允许我配置设备的对话框,并且有一个红框,试图告诉我一些东西:

enter image description here

这个红色的盒子试图告诉我什么? 如何配置设备进行远程调试?
如何在Visual Studio 2015 Update 2中调试设备驱动程序? 1

1 社区版

1 个答案:

答案 0 :(得分:1)

我遇到了同样的问题:"红框"花了几个小时在网上搜索答案。然后意识到"红框"来自另一个Dialog元素,正如您在官方文档中看到的那样。

enter image description here

所以解决方案是调整大小"设备配置"对话窗口。